Goss Moor Touring and Camping is a delightful family-run site nestled down a quiet country lane. It offers a peaceful, back-to-basics experience amidst nature, with fields, trees, and moorland providing a serene backdrop. The campsite is equipped with essential facilities like clean toilets, showers, and electric hookups, ensuring a comfortable stay. The owners are known for their warm hospitality, and the site welcomes dogs, making it perfect for families and nature lovers alike.

The local area is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. With its proximity to Newquay and the broader Cornish landscape, there are plenty of opportunities for wonderful walks and activities. The nearby moors offer stunning sunsets and breathtaking starry night skies, thanks to the minimal light pollution. Goss Moor itself is a haven for wildlife, with regular visits from deer and rabbits. The campsite’s tranquil setting encourages exploration of the surrounding countryside, while being close enough to enjoy the attractions and amenities of nearby towns.
